Tapendra Giri vs State Of U P And Another

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|28 November, 2019
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 79
Case :- APPLICATION U/S 482 No. - 43097 of 2019 Applicant :- Tapendra Giri Opposite Party :- State of U.P. and Another Counsel for Applicant :- Ishan Deo Giri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A.
Hon'ble Ajit Singh,J.
Heard learned counsel the applicant and learned A.G.A. for the State and perused the record The present 482 Cr.P.C. petition has been filed for quashing the order dated 24.10.2019 passed by learned Chief Judicial Magistrate, Gautam Budh Nagar, under Sections 323, 504, 506 and 354 I.P.C., P.S. Sector-58 Noida, district-Gautam Budh Nagar, by which the non-bailable warrant has been issued against the applicant as well as the entire proceedings.
Learned counsel for the applicant contended that the reasons on account of which the applicant failed to appear before the trial court on several dates after being enlarged on bail, were beyond his control and the applicant has every intention to appear before the court concerned and participate in the proceedings of the trial.
After having considered the submissions made by the learned counsel for the applicant and perused the impugned order as well as the other materials brought on record, without expressing any opinion on the merits of the case, I dispose of this application with a direction that in case the applicant moves an application with the prayer for cancelling the non- bailable warrant issued against him before the court below within two weeks from today along with the certified copy of this order, in that case the concerned court shall pass appropriate order.
Order Date :- 28.11.2019 Faridul
